Traditions still matter at Wrigley Field, no matter how trivial they may seem to outsiders. It’s what makes Wrigley a place like no other.

The Chicago Cubs’ final regular season home game at Wrigley Field on Sunday afternoon was probably not unlike the end of their first season at the ballpark 107 years ago, albeit with more fans and richer players.
